Canada's Drug Agency has made a significant shift in its stance on Alzheimer's disease treatment, recommending that public drug plans cover a disease-modifying medication, lecanemab, with specific conditions. This move marks a notable change from their initial position, which was to deny public funding for the drug due to efficacy and safety concerns. The Canadian Drug Expert Committee (CDEC) has now concluded that lecanemab may address a significant unmet clinical need, despite the uncertainty in its clinical value. What makes this particularly fascinating is the CDEC's reconsideration of its initial review, which was based on imprecise and unclear evidence. The committee received new information and feedback from clinical specialists, patient advocacy organizations, and public drug plans, which led to a more nuanced understanding of the drug's benefits and risks. One thing that immediately stands out is the CDEC's recommendation that lecanemab be publicly reimbursed with conditions. These conditions include age restrictions, genetic eligibility, and ongoing monitoring through MRI scans. While these conditions are necessary to ensure patient safety and appropriate use of the drug, they also raise questions about accessibility and equity. What many people don't realize is that the high cost of lecanemab, $30,000 a year, has been a significant barrier to access. The CDA's updated recommendation, however, sets the stage for public funding to cover the medication, which could improve access for eligible patients. If the CDA recommendation is finalized, it will likely trigger price negotiations between the pan-Canadian Pharmaceutical Alliance and the drug manufacturer, Eisai Co., Ltd. A detail that I find especially interesting is the comparison between lecanemab and donanemab, another disease-modifying medication for Alzheimer's disease. While donanemab has also been approved by Health Canada, it is unclear if public drug plans will cover it.
